Cuvierina Boas, 1886

Dataset
GBIF Backbone Taxonomy
Rank
GENUS
Published in
Boas, J. E. V. (1886). Spolia Atlantica. Bidrag til pteropodernes Morfologi og Systematik samt til Kundskaben om deres geografiske Udbredelse. Kongelige Danske Videnskabernes Selskabs Skrifter, (6)4:1–231, figs. A–Q, pls. 1–8. (copepod pp.34). https://www.molluscabase.org/aphia.php?p=sourcedetails&id=39257

Classification

kingdom
Animalia
phylum
Mollusca
class
Gastropoda
order
Pteropoda
family
Cavoliniidae
genus
Cuvierina

Name

Synonyms
Cuviera Knocker, 1869
Cuvieria Rang, 1827
Herse Gistel, 1848
Hyperia Gistel, 1848
Rangistela Pruvot-Fol, 1948
Tripteris Menke, 1830
Urceolaria A.W.Jannsen, 2005
Urceolarica A.W.Janssen, 2006
